Output d7d5c3e200810e779b9d862763291e8420768718a642360db6180f280a19c998:29

value
542220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e835b018516c6d885e2b65300addbfc3ef6e9451 OP_EQUALVERIFY OP_CHECKSIG
address
1NAp5obRP6DdM77JUF4YcvacoFX3uos5Kh
transaction
d7d5c3e200810e779b9d862763291e8420768718a642360db6180f280a19c998
confirmations
58489
spent
true